Medicare Improvements for Patients and Providers Act of 2008 (MIPPA) (PubLNo 110-275)

The Social Security Act sections related to the Medicare and Medicaid programs, as published in the CCH Medicare and Medicaid Guide, have been updated to reflect the “Medicare Improvements for Patients and Providers Act of 2008” (MIPPA) (PubLNo 110-275). The law section now includes revisions of existing law, the addition of new sections enacted by MIPPA, and updated amendment notes and histories.

Medicare Improvements for Patients and Providers Act of 2008

On July 15, 2008, the Medicare Improvements for Patients and Providers Act of 2008 (MIPPA) (PubLNo 110-275) was enacted. As a result of this new legislation many payment systems and other Medicare programs were immediately affected.
